Transaction e555bf02345f76b7d7c90864bc6ecd6181ee818c7139effa81f975c10a04f523
1 Input
1 Output
-
e555bf02345f76b7d7c90864bc6ecd6181ee818c7139effa81f975c10a04f523:0
- value
- 26602
- script pubkey
- OP_0 OP_PUSHBYTES_20 88e29290c5013b9676f9e6a0f6c25c9311205f50
- address
- bc1q3r3f9yx9qyaevaheu6s0dsjujvgjqh6sq8wkwx